'House of Cards' Season 4 Trailer Promises Big Underwood Drama

Those hoping for calmer waters in Frank and Claire Underwood’s relationship will be disappointed by Netflix’s House of Cards season four trailer, which shows the couple at odds — and teases a war between them like no other.

“You have no idea what it means to have nothing,” Kevin Spacey’s Frank says in a voiceover. “You don’t value what we have achieved. I have had to fight for everything my entire life.”

Along with their battle for power, the trailer also teases the addition of Ellen Burstyn to the cast, who can be seen briefly in the minute-long clip.

“I saw a future. Our future,” says Robin Wright’s Claire.

“We had a future until you started destroying it,” replies Frank.

New cast member Joel Kinnaman also appears in the trailer, and looks like he could be a rival for Frank, who already has enough on his plate. It also gives a glimpse at Neve Campbell’s character.

Returning players include congresswoman Jackie Sharp (Molly Parker) and Remy Danton (Mahershala Ali), who seem to be taking on some more drama, along with Russian president Viktor Petrov (Lars Mikkelsen).

Netflix has already renewed House of Cards for season five. However, creator Beau Willimon will not be returning for the next season.
